Yield — soft wheat

Triticum aestivum L.

The yield of soft wheat is determined by the genetic potential of the variety and environmental conditions, measured in t/ha or dt/ha adjusted to a standard moisture content of 14%. It is composed of stand density, number of grains per ear, and thousand-kernel weight (TKW).

During variety trials, soft wheat grain yield is adjusted to a standard moisture content of 14%. Competitive trials utilize plot experiments with multiple replications, where after harvesting, the grain is cleaned and weighed to determine the actual productivity of the crop.

The potential of modern winter soft wheat varieties under intensive management reaches 10–12 t/ha, while spring wheat reaches 5–7 t/ha; however, these figures vary significantly depending on agro-climatic conditions and the region. Yield stability is assessed through the homeostatic capacity of the variety.

The yield structure is formed based on three main elements: the number of productive ears per 1 m², the number of grains per ear, and the thousand-kernel weight. At the same time, the breeding process requires maintaining a balance between high productivity and grain quality traits, such as protein and gluten content.
